Propranolol and flunarizine are both medications used to treat different medical conditions. Let's take a closer look at each of them:
Propranolol is a medication that belongs to a class of drugs called beta-blockers. It primarily works by blocking the effects of adrenaline (epinephrine) in the body.
It is commonly prescribed to treat several conditions, including hypertension (high blood pressure), angina (chest pain), heart rhythm disorders, and certain types of tremors.
Flunarizine is a medication that belongs to the class of calcium channel blockers. It works by inhibiting the influx of calcium ions into cells, thereby reducing the excessive calcium-related activity in certain tissues.
Flunarizine is primarily prescribed to prevent migraines and to treat certain vestibular disorders, which affect the inner ear and balance.
